    Top 10 Year-End Function Venues in Gauteng (2025)

    Kholofelo ModiseBy Kholofelo Modise16 October , 2025Updated:12 March , 2026
    WhatsApp Facebook Twitter Copy Link Telegram LinkedIn Email
    Top 10 Year-End Function Venues in Gauteng (2025)
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email

    As 2025 draws to a close, many South African companies are already planning their year-end celebrations — a time to reflect, recharge, and recognise hard work. Whether you’re arranging a sophisticated gala, a relaxed outdoor braai, or a vibrant party night, Gauteng offers a wide variety of venues to suit every style and budget.

    To help you choose the perfect location, we’ve rounded up 10 of the best year-end function venues in Gauteng for 2025, based on reviews, facilities, and overall experience. Each venue offers something special — from luxury settings and lush gardens to trendy urban spaces ideal for unforgettable festivities.

    Top 10 Year-End Function Venues in Gauteng (2025)

    1. The Garden Venue Hotel (Northriding, Johannesburg)

    Rating: ★★★★☆ (4.4/5 from 3,382 reviews)
    Contact: +27 11 795 0000 | Website

    If you’re looking for elegance, greenery, and tranquillity, The Garden Venue Hotel is hard to beat. Nestled in Northriding, this award-winning space combines beautifully landscaped gardens with versatile event halls perfect for corporate gatherings and festive functions alike.

    With onsite catering, free parking, and a full-service restaurant, The Garden Venue makes event planning seamless. Whether you prefer an intimate cocktail evening or a grand dinner under the stars, the professional event coordinators ensure your function is as polished as it is memorable.

    Ideal for: Corporate galas, formal dinners, and outdoor celebrations.

    2. The Venue Melrose Arch (Melrose, Johannesburg)

    Rating: ★★★★☆ (4.5/5 from 790 reviews)
    Contact: +27 11 214 4300 | Website

    For a sleek, cosmopolitan setting in one of Johannesburg’s most stylish precincts, The Venue Melrose Arch is a top contender. Known for its modern design and world-class event management, this venue offers state-of-the-art facilities, wheelchair access, and catering flexibility to suit your event’s needs.

    Conveniently located near top hotels and restaurants, it’s perfect for companies wanting a touch of urban sophistication. Whether you’re hosting a black-tie event or a themed year-end party, expect a seamless blend of class and comfort.

    Ideal for: Professional corporate events and elegant year-end dinners.

    3. The Empire Conference and Events Venue (Parktown, Johannesburg)

    Rating: ★★★★☆ (4.5/5 from 153 reviews)
    Contact: +27 11 340 9535 | Website

    Centrally located in Parktown, The Empire Conference and Events Venue offers a balance of convenience and professionalism. This venue is well-loved for its versatility — accommodating anything from strategy sessions to lavish end-of-year banquets.

    With free parking, easy accessibility, and a dedicated events team, The Empire is a practical yet stylish choice for companies seeking a well-organised and smooth celebration experience.

    Ideal for: Mid-sized businesses and professional conferences that roll into evening festivities.

    4. Rugged Rose Function Venue & Conference Facility (Muldersdrift)

    Rating: ★★★★★ (4.9/5 from 40 reviews)
    Contact: +27 79 210 8959 | Website

    For those who appreciate personalised service and a charming, flexible setting, Rugged Rose Function Venue is a hidden gem. Located in the scenic Muldersdrift area, it’s renowned for its warm hospitality, inclusive amenities, and ability to tailor each event to its guests’ vision.

    The venue’s rustic charm and relaxed atmosphere make it ideal for year-end celebrations that feel both professional and personal. You can expect attention to detail and a team that goes above and beyond to bring your event to life.

    Ideal for: Intimate gatherings, creative companies, and laid-back corporate parties.

    5. The Fox Event Venue + The Good Luck Bar (Ferreirasdorp, Johannesburg)

    Rating: ★★★★☆ (4.3/5 from 889 reviews)
    Contact: +27 84 395 7770 | Website

    If you want your year-end function to be anything but boring, The Fox Event Venue offers a vibrant, industrial-chic vibe right in Johannesburg’s city centre. This converted warehouse space, paired with The Good Luck Bar, creates a trendy, urban atmosphere that’s perfect for live entertainment, themed events, or after-hours celebrations.

    Its unique layout and energetic ambiance attract creative agencies, start-ups, and teams that love a good party. It’s a place where you can celebrate achievements in true Jozi style.

    Ideal for: Young teams, festive parties, and live music lovers.

    6. The View Wedding and Events Venue (Kibler Park, Johannesburg)

    Rating: ★★★★☆ (4.6/5 from 410 reviews)
    Contact: Website

    The View lives up to its name, offering stunning cityscapes and a relaxed yet elegant setting in Kibler Park. Known for being LGBTQ+ friendly and highly accommodating, this venue provides multiple amenities and layout options for a wide range of celebrations.

    With extended operating hours (open until 10 PM), it’s perfect for teams who want to make the most of the evening without rushing through their festivities.

    Ideal for: Inclusive, welcoming celebrations and teams seeking a scenic backdrop.

    7. The Venue Green Park (Sandton, Johannesburg)

    Rating: ★★★★☆ (4.5/5 from 351 reviews)
    Contact: +27 11 783 0077 | Website

    Located in the heart of Sandton, The Venue Green Park combines contemporary design with outstanding service. It’s a modern and versatile space equipped with the latest technology, making it suitable for everything from formal dinners to high-energy themed parties.

    With ample parking, accessibility features, and professional event planning support, this venue is a corporate favourite for good reason. Its sleek interiors also provide the perfect canvas for creative décor.

    Ideal for: Large corporate teams and formal end-of-year banquets.

    8. 55 Tulbagh Events and Wedding Venue (Kempton Park)

    Rating: ★★★★★ (4.8/5 from 180 reviews)
    Contact: +27 82 356 7220 | Website

    Women-owned and highly rated, 55 Tulbagh Events and Wedding Venue in Kempton Park stands out for its personal touch and boutique feel. Guests rave about the exceptional service, stunning interiors, and well-maintained grounds — making it a popular choice for companies seeking a more intimate and elegant setting.

    The venue offers various packages and is flexible enough to accommodate corporate themes, awards nights, or festive luncheons.

    Ideal for: Boutique companies, private events, and team appreciation dinners.

    9. Over The Edge Party Venue (Boksburg)

    Rating: ★★★★☆ (4.6/5 from 60 reviews)
    Contact: +27 81 043 2600 | Website

    Over The Edge Party Venue is where practicality meets fun. Open 24 hours and fully wheelchair-accessible, it’s a great option for businesses that want flexibility — whether hosting an afternoon celebration or an all-night party.

    The spacious layout accommodates large groups comfortably, and the venue’s versatility means you can customise the setup to suit your theme, from casual braais to glitzy events.

    Ideal for: Large companies and teams that love to celebrate late.

    10. The Garden Venue – Corporate Year-End Function Venues (Johannesburg)


    Rating: ★★★★☆ (4.5/5 from 351 reviews)
    Contact: +27 11 783 0077 | Website

    If your company wants to host a truly memorable and hassle-free year-end celebration, The Garden Venue’s dedicated corporate function packages are designed to impress. From elegant banquet halls to outdoor garden settings, the venue provides professional event coordination, décor services, and gourmet catering — all under one roof.

    With tailored packages for small to large teams, The Garden Venue makes it easy to celebrate success in style while enjoying a peaceful, scenic environment just minutes from the city.

    Ideal for: Corporate teams seeking a full-service, all-in-one event solution in Johannesburg.

    Whether your team prefers a luxurious setting, a trendy inner-city vibe, or a relaxed garden celebration, Gauteng has a venue to match every company’s personality. The best part? These spaces not only provide great aesthetics but also professional service, convenience, and comfort — ensuring your 2025 year-end function is one to remember.

    When choosing your venue, consider:

    • Guest count and accessibility (especially for employees with mobility needs)
    • Parking and transport options
    • Catering flexibility and dietary preferences
    • Availability during peak festive season

    With early planning and the right location, your year-end function can be the perfect send-off to a successful 2025 — setting the tone for an even brighter year ahead.
